Brick foundation sealing is a process that involves applying a specialized waterproof coating to the exterior surface of a brick foundation. This service helps create a barrier that prevents moisture from seeping into the bricks and the underlying structure. Proper sealing can protect the foundation from water infiltration during heavy rains or snowmelt, which is especially important in areas like Philadelphia where seasonal weather can cause water-related issues. When performed correctly by experienced service providers, sealing can extend the lifespan of a brick foundation and help maintain the structural integrity of a property.
This service addresses common problems such as rising damp, efflorescence, and water intrusion that can lead to more serious issues over time. Moisture that penetrates the brickwork can cause mortar deterioration, mold growth, and even foundation settling if left untreated. Sealing the bricks helps to mitigate these risks by reducing water absorption, which in turn minimizes the potential for damage caused by freeze-thaw cycles and moisture-related expansion. Homeowners noticing increased dampness, efflorescence on brick surfaces, or cracks in the foundation may find that sealing offers a practical solution to these issues.

The overview below groups typical Brick Foundation Sealing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Philadelphia, PA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or sealing needs around individual cracks or small areas,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the extent of the damage and accessibility.
Standard Sealant Applications - Larger, more comprehensive sealing projects for typical residential foundations often range from $600 to $1,500. Most projects in this category are straightforward and fall within this middle price band.
Extensive or Complex Projects - Foundations requiring extensive sealing due to multiple cracks or irregular surfaces can cost $1,500 to $3,000. Fewer projects reach this tier, but larger homes or complicated conditions may push costs higher.
Full Foundation Sealing or Replacement - Complete sealing or foundation work involving significant repairs can range from $3,000 to over $5,000. These larger projects are less common and depend heavily on the size and condition of the foundation.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
